Latitude Menu
1. From a Home screen, touch
Apps ➔
Latitude.
2. Touch
, if necessary.
3. Touch
Menu for these options:
• Add friends: Share your location with friends. For more
information, refer to “Sharing Your Location with
Friends” on page 88.
• Check in: Touch a location to check-in so others will know your
location.
• Refresh friends: Update your Latitude list of friends.
• Show stale friends / Hide stale friends: Show or hide friends
depending on the accuracy of their Latitude information.
• Location settings: Configures the location reporting settings.
